How Many Words Is a 15 Minute Speech?

How many words is a 15 minute speech? A 15 minute speech usually contains about 1950 to 2250 words, depending speaking speed and dellvery.

Understanding speech word counts helps speakers prepare presentations that stay within time limits.

Average Speaking Speed

Most people speak at an average speed of 130 to 150 words per minute when delivering a speech.

Word Count by Speaking Speed

Different speakers talk at different speeds.

Typical estimates for a 15 minute speech include:

  • Slow speaker (120 WPM) about 1800 words
  • Average speaker (140 WPM) about 2100 words
  • Fast speaker (160 WPM) about 2400 words

Pauses and audience interaction may slightly change the final speech length.

How to Practice a 15 Minute Speech

Practicing your speech is important to make sure it fits within the 15 minute time limit. Even if your word count is accurate, speaking pace, pauses, and emphasis can affect your timing.

To practice effectively:

• read your speech out loud
• use a timer
• record yourself to check pacing
• adjust sections that feel too long or short

Practicing helps ensure your speech sounds natural and stays within the expected time.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many words should a 15 minute speech be? A 15 minute speech is usually about 1950 to 2250 words.

How many pages is a 15 minute speech? A 15 minute speech is usually about 7 to 9 pages double spaced depending on formatting.

How long does it take to say 2000 words? Most speakers take about 14 to 15 minutes to say 2000 words.
